Updated April 2, 2026: Need to catch up on classical recordings? Try this spring bouquet of new releases from composers Osvaldo Golijov, Kevin Puts and Thomas Adès, plus albums from The Tallis Scholars, Tanya Tagaq, Mary Lattimore, Alice Sara Ott, Daniel Bjarnason and the Turtle Island String Quartet.


Need a deep discovery experience? Try 1,000 years of music in this playlist from NPR Classical's Tom Huizenga, which explores everything from new releases to old favorites, and classics from the dawn of the recording era. Our mantra: Bach, Beethoven, before and beyond.
